      Slovakia VS Malta Slovakia's recent form has been quite promising, while Malta has been struggling. This significant gap in overall strength and player value is evident. Slovakia's total team value exceeds 110 million euros, more than seven times that of Malta, which is around 14.75 million euros. This vast disparity in hard power suggests that the game is likely to turn into a one - sided affair, with the home team, Slovakia, having absolute ball - control and offensive dominance. The tactical styles of the two teams are in stark contrast. Slovakia's coach, Weiss, is likely to use a 4 - 2 - 3 - 1 or 4 - 3 - 3 formation, aiming to test the lineup through flanking attacks and penetrations in the flanks. On the other hand, Malta usually adopts a highly pragmatic low - block 5 - 4 - 1 or 4 - 5 - 1 formation against strong opponents.
